If the mean of 5 positive integers is 15, what is the maximum possible difference between the largest and the smallest of these
igomit [66]

Answer:

64

Step-by-step explanation:

If the mean is 15, the sum of 5 numbers is:

  • 5*15 = 75

Minimum value for the first four numbers would be:

  • 1, 2, 3, 4

Then the fifth number is:

  • 75 - (1+2+3+4) = 75 - 10 = 65

So the maximum difference is:

  • 65 - 1 = 64
